KPI Tree

Customer.io Metric

Marketing Automation

Stage Progression Rate = (Customers Advancing to Next Stage / Customers in Current Stage) x 100

Lifecycle stage progression measures the rate at which customers advance through defined lifecycle stages - such as lead, activated, engaged, loyal, and at-risk - within Customer.io workflows. It quantifies how effectively your messaging programme moves customers toward higher-value states.

Customer.ioMarketing Automation

Lifecycle Stage Progression

Lifecycle stage progression measures the rate at which customers advance through defined lifecycle stages - such as lead, activated, engaged, loyal, and at-risk - within Customer.io workflows. It quantifies how effectively your messaging programme moves customers toward higher-value states.

How to calculate lifecycle stage progression

Stage Progression Rate = (Customers Advancing to Next Stage / Customers in Current Stage) x 100

Why lifecycle stage progression matters for Customer.io users

Customer.io workflows are designed to move customers through their lifecycle, but measuring individual message performance does not tell you whether the overall journey is working. A customer may open every email but never advance from trial to paid. Stage progression reveals whether your messaging programme achieves its strategic purpose.

Tracking progression in your metric tree connects tactical messaging metrics to strategic lifecycle outcomes. When progression stalls at a specific stage, the tree reveals which workflows and messages are responsible for the bottleneck.

Understand and act on lifecycle stage progression with KPI Tree

KPI Tree connects lifecycle stage data from your warehouse and tracks transition rates between stages. Map progression metrics into your metric tree with upstream campaign and workflow metrics feeding into them.

Assign RACI ownership to your lifecycle marketing lead. Set alerts when progression rates decline at any stage and track actions taken to improve the workflows responsible for that transition.

Get started with your Customer.io data

Query using MCP
MCP

Pull metrics from Customer.io directly through the Model Context Protocol.

Data Warehouse
SnowflakeBigQueryDatabricksRedshift

Connect your existing warehouse where Customer.io data already lands.

Professional Services
FivetranSnowflakedbt

Our professional services team can build you turn-key AI foundations in a matter of weeks. Data warehouse on Snowflake/BigQuery, ELT with Fivetran, all modelled in dbt with a semantic layer.

Related Customer.io metrics

Customer Journey Mapping

Marketing Automation

Metric Definition

Customer journey mapping traces the sequence of Customer.io touchpoints a customer experiences from first contact through conversion and beyond. It visualises the paths customers take through workflows, campaigns, and transactional messages, identifying the most common and most effective journey patterns.

View metric

Workflow Completion Rate

Marketing Automation

Metric Definition

Workflow Completion Rate = (Recipients Completing Workflow / Recipients Entering Workflow) x 100

Workflow completion rate measures the percentage of Customer.io recipients who progress through an entire automated workflow from entry to final step. It indicates how effectively your workflows retain recipients through multi-step sequences and whether the full journey delivers its intended outcome.

View metric

Campaign Conversion Rate

Marketing Automation

Metric Definition

Campaign Conversion Rate = (Conversions / Messages Delivered) x 100

Campaign conversion rate measures the percentage of recipients who complete a desired action after receiving a Customer.io campaign message. It connects message delivery to business outcomes such as purchases, signups, or feature activations, providing a direct measure of campaign effectiveness.

View metric

Customer Reactivation Rate

Marketing Automation

Metric Definition

Reactivation Rate = (Reactivated Customers / Targeted Inactive Customers) x 100

Customer reactivation rate measures the percentage of lapsed or inactive customers who re-engage after receiving Customer.io reactivation campaigns. It quantifies the effectiveness of win-back workflows in recovering customers who have stopped interacting with your product or service.

View metric

Segment Growth Rate

Marketing Automation

Metric Definition

Segment Growth Rate = ((Segment Size End - Segment Size Start) / Segment Size Start) x 100

Segment growth rate measures the rate at which a Customer.io audience segment expands or contracts over a given period. It tracks the net change in segment membership, accounting for new additions, removals, and natural attrition to assess the health and trajectory of key audience cohorts.

View metric

Empower your team to understand and act on Customer.io data

Map what drives your metrics, measure progress at any grain, prove what works statistically, and deliver personalised action plans to every team member.

Experience That Matters

Built by a team that's been in your shoes

Our team brings deep experience from leading Data, Growth and People teams at some of the fastest growing scaleups in Europe through to IPO and beyond. We've faced the same challenges you're facing now.

Checkout.com
Planet
UK Government
Travelex
BT
Sainsbury's
Goldman Sachs
Dojo
Redpin
Farfetch
Just Eat for Business